a972514177
2020-05-07 14:49
采纳率: 33.3%
浏览 624
已采纳

怎么将查询获得的数据显示在JSP界面。

我有一个订单表,现在要统计我在某月某商品的销售额,查询语句我会,已经成功的查询出来了,现在问题是不知道怎样把查询出来的数据放到JSP页面中。
这是我的查询语句:(表名是alldeliver time代表下单时间,我只取月份,pricr是物品单价,type是物品类型)

SELECT month(time) as month,type,sum(price) FROM alldeliver GROUP BY month(time),type

在数据库查询的结果显示为:
图片说明

是我想要的结果 但是由于我的这个表里没有month和sum(price)所以不知道该如何在JSP界面获得查询结果 求各位大佬给点思路qaq

  • 写回答
  • 关注问题
  • 收藏
  • 邀请回答

2条回答 默认 最新

  • threenewbee 2020-05-07 14:51
    已采纳

    SELECT month(time) as month,type,sum(price) as sumprice FROM alldeliver GROUP BY month(time),type
    这样就有month和sumprice两个列了

    具体代码类似
    https://www.runoob.com/jsp/jsp-database-access.html

    已采纳该答案
    打赏 评论
  • 栗子_yangxw 2020-05-07 15:21

    1.首先你要写一个servlet程序,可以成功与web页面交换数据
    2.在你的servlet中连接数据库查询你要的数据(可以通过德鲁伊、或者原生jdbc)
    3.封装你的数据到response响应里面
    4.jsp页面取出你的数据,封装到列表。取出方式也很简单,【返回对象.属性】就可以

    打赏 评论

相关推荐 更多相似问题